Quick Tip: What Is AR-15 "Dwell Time"?

This expert-level guide from Brownells explains AR-15 dwell time, a critical concept for builders and troubleshooters. Dwell time is defined as the duration gases from a fired cartridge act on the firearm's operating system, specifically the bolt carrier group. Understanding its relationship with gas system length and gas port proximity is key to diagnosing and preventing malfunctions.

Quick Summary

AR-15 dwell time is the period during which gases from a fired cartridge act upon the firearm's operating system, particularly the bolt carrier group. It's influenced by gas system length; shorter systems mean more dwell time and higher pressure, while longer systems mean less dwell time and lower pressure. Understanding this is key for building and troubleshooting.

Frequently Asked Questions

What is dwell time on an AR-15?

Dwell time on an AR-15 is the duration that gases from a fired cartridge exert pressure on the firearm's operating system, specifically the bolt carrier group. It's a critical factor in how the rifle cycles.

How does gas system length affect dwell time in an AR-15?

Shorter gas systems (pistol, carbine) have gas ports closer to the chamber, leading to longer dwell times and higher gas pressure. Longer systems (mid-length, rifle) have ports further away, resulting in shorter dwell times and lower gas pressure.

What is the correct way to diagnose AR-15 gas system issues?

The most effective way to diagnose gas-related malfunctions in an AR-15 is by observing the ejection pattern of spent casings. Consistent patterns indicate proper gas system function, while erratic patterns suggest issues.

Can you directly measure AR-15 dwell time?

No, dwell time cannot be measured with a stopwatch. It's a conceptual understanding of how long gas pressure acts on the system, influenced by factors like gas port size and gas system length, not a discrete event with a start and end time.
